//I'm just curious, how closely does the DM team look at donated items? Is the overall donation value the most important thing, or is the quality or number of items more important? Particularly because things like healing potions have such a low lens value compared to their utility, I don't donate them as a matter of course... (or say, how metal helmets are all but worthless, but I'd rather like to be wearing one in battle ;)) but if the team is looking at the individual items, my characters might donate more of that kind of item. Similarly, I tend to donate few, high-value armors, but if the team is looking at things realistically, one person with even really good armor isn't going to make as big a difference as the dozens of mediocre armor that would be the value equivalent. Obviously, this makes a difference in how one donates.

I think you're thinking of it the wrong way - absolutely, anything can be used for evil torture-y effects... and absolutely poisons can be used to good effect.... BUT, the poisons that are mechanically craftable in game are the probably the ways that require some moral flexibility to use.

If you want to RP using poisons to concoct antidotes, I don't see anything wrong with that... its just more the province of the heal skill or alchemy craft than poisoncrafting. Just think of the poisoncrafting skill as a small subset of everything that one can do using poisons.

Okay, two very distinct issues that this idea presents: First, I have no idea whether Layo pit creatures can possess others. Regardless, that is likely an Ed question, but I have my suspicions that it would not be allowed for a PC without being introduced on a quest or something like that.

The second issue is the idea of having two very distinct personas possibly creating alignment issues. "Insatiable desire to kill and destroy" is pretty much the definition of CE, and would not be allowed as part of a character for obvious reasons. We have had characters with a similar sort of split personality without possession (e.g. mental illness), but they required a great deal of careful definition from the player, in order to deal with any potential issues, and anything that would cause alignment violations would not be allowed.
